Numbers key people
Numbers is carried by mediators who stand in the gap, the faithful spies who trust God, and the rebels and enemies who oppose His purposes.
The faithful: leaders, priests, and the new inheritors
Moses
Leader, prophet, and intercessor, who repeatedly stands between God and a rebellious people
Aaron
The high priest, whose budding staff vindicates his office; dies at Mount Hor
Miriam
Moses’ sister and a prophetess; struck with leprosy for opposing Moses, and dies at Kadesh
Joshua
One of the two faithful spies, commissioned as Moses’ successor
Caleb
The other faithful spy, who “wholly followed the LORD” and is promised the land
Eleazar
Aaron’s son, who succeeds him as high priest
Phinehas
Eleazar’s son, whose zeal at Peor stops the plague and earns a covenant of perpetual priesthood
The daughters of Zelophehad
Five sisters whose appeal secures inheritance rights for daughters
The rebels and the enemy hired to curse Israel
Korah, Dathan, and Abiram
The leaders of the rebellion against Moses and Aaron, swallowed by the earth
Balaam
The pagan prophet hired to curse Israel, whom God compels to bless
Balak
The king of Moab who hires Balaam
